OCRHelper

一个基本助手,用于将光学字符识别流程应用于图像,以获取文本。

此包兼容MacOS、TvOS、iOS、ipadOS 和 WatchOS。

如何使用

此包仅包含类 OCRHelper

如何获取支持的语言

let languages: [String] = OCRHelper.supportedLanguages

注意: 如果数组为空,则不允许识别系统。

如何从图像中获取文本

有针对 CGImage、UIImage 和 NSImage 格式的函数。

let myImage = // type your code here to get an image
OCRHelper.recognice(cgImage: myImage, 
    languages: ["es-es", "en-us"],
    level: .accurate,
    completed: { result, error in
    guard let result = result else { return }
    for item in result {
        print(item)
    }
})

注意: 参数 language 和 level 是可选的。

作者

此包由 Jonathan Chacón 开发。

如有任何问题或建议,请通过 Tyflos Accessible Software 网站与我联系。

贡献

欢迎提交 Pull Request。 欢迎随时创建 Pull Request 以进行任何类型的改进、错误修复或增强。 对于重大更改,请先打开一个 Issue,讨论您想要更改的内容。

许可证

本软件已在 MIT 许可证下发布